OK, I'm now a T-38 Advanced owner and have a question for the gallery. Is anyone having trouble installing under FSX Steam Edition? My install runs fine, but I have no T-38 item in the add-ons pulldown menu, so I can't access the realism menu. Realism is set to "hard." Engines won't start - I get the ticking sound but no increase in RPM. Checked the dll.xml and found no references to the T-38, which I suspect is the issue. Went looking to see if the necessary lines were written somewhere else but so far haven't been able to find them. Uninstalled, re-downloaded and re-installed, all with antivirus off, but no joy. Just an update to report that thanks to the support forum, I've solved my problem accessing the failure generator. It requires the 2013 version of the Visual C++ redistributable (x86), which I hadn't installed. Managed a hot start my first time running the failure system. Fun! Off to cause more damage now...
